Understanding Lithium Commodity Price Dynamics

Lithium, a light and highly reactive alkali metal, is indispensable for modern technology, most notably in rechargeable batteries. The primary sources of lithium are hard-rock mining (spodumene) and brine evaporation from salt lakes. The extraction process is resource-intensive, often requiring significant capital investment and a considerable environmental footprint, which inherently impacts supply and, consequently, pricing. Global production is concentrated in a few key regions, making the supply chain susceptible to disruptions, whether from geological challenges, political instability, or logistical bottlenecks. This concentration of supply has historically led to price volatility. The lithium commodity price is not determined by a single exchange like some other commodities; rather, it is influenced by a complex interplay of contract negotiations between producers and consumers, spot market assessments, and the pricing of lithium derivatives like lithium carbonate and lithium hydroxide.

The burgeoning demand from the electric vehicle sector is the most significant driver for lithium consumption. As major automakers commit to electrifying their fleets, the demand for EV batteries, and thus lithium, escalates. Renewable energy storage, such as large-scale battery systems for solar and wind farms, further amplifies this demand. This surge in consumption, coupled with the relatively slow pace of new mine development and the technical complexities of lithium extraction, creates a fundamental imbalance that pushes prices upwards. Furthermore, the refining capacity for lithium products is another critical bottleneck. Even if raw lithium ore is abundant, the ability to process it into battery-grade materials is essential, and this capacity is also concentrated, adding another layer of complexity to price determination. Factors Influencing Lithium Prices

Several key factors contribute to the fluctuations in the lithium commodity price. Firstly, supply and demand imbalances are paramount. The rapid growth in EV sales has outpaced new supply coming online, leading to significant price increases. Secondly, production costs play a role. Mining and processing lithium, especially in challenging geological conditions or with stricter environmental regulations, can be expensive. These costs are passed on to consumers, influencing the market price. Thirdly, geopolitical factors can have a substantial impact. Major lithium-producing countries often have complex political landscapes, and any instability can disrupt supply and create price shocks. For instance, events in South America’s ‘lithium triangle’ or resource-rich Australia can send ripples through the global market.

Technological advancements in battery technology also influence lithium demand. Innovations that improve battery energy density or reduce reliance on cobalt, for example, could indirectly affect lithium demand and pricing. Conversely, breakthroughs in extraction technologies, such as direct lithium extraction (DLE) from brines, could potentially increase supply and stabilize prices in the long term. The grade and type of lithium product also matter; battery-grade lithium carbonate and hydroxide command higher prices than technical-grade materials. Finally, speculative trading and market sentiment, though less dominant than fundamental supply and demand, can also contribute to short-term price volatility. Technological Innovations and Their Impact

Technological innovation is a double-edged sword for the lithium market. On one hand, advancements in battery chemistry that increase energy density, reduce charging times, or improve safety are driving demand for higher-quality lithium compounds. Innovations like solid-state batteries, which promise greater safety and energy density, could reshape the battery market and, by extension, lithium demand. On the other hand, research into alternative battery chemistries that use less or no lithium, such as sodium-ion batteries, could offer a long-term challenge to lithium’s dominance. While currently not as energy-dense as lithium-ion, sodium-ion batteries offer potential advantages in cost and availability, especially for stationary energy storage applications.

In the mining and processing sector, technologies like Direct Lithium Extraction (DLE) are gaining traction. DLE aims to extract lithium more efficiently and with a smaller environmental footprint from brine sources, potentially opening up new reserves and increasing global supply. If these technologies mature and become cost-effective, they could significantly influence the lithium commodity price by increasing supply.
